With no graduation day in sight, this could be the closest thing seniors have to a celebration.
(Lawrenceburg, Ind.) - A high school student from Lawrenceburg is doing something special for seniors who in all likelihood won't get a graduation day.
Adam Duwel, a junior at Elder High School, is set to premiere "Dear Class of 2020" on Tuesday evening at 7:00 p.m.
The video is will feature dozens of tri-state area high schools, including Lawrenceburg High School, South Dearborn High School and East Central High School.
Duwel presented the idea to fellow classmates via social media on March 23. Within a week, more than 100 videos from seniors across the country poured in.
For most seniors across the country, this could be the closest thing they get to celebrate graduating high school.
